Bombay Sambar or besan sambar is a quick and instant sambar prepared with gram flour or besan. It is a very simple and tasty sambar and needs very less ingredients.It is a perfect side dish for idli and dosa.
Mix gram flour or besan with little water first without lumps. Then add 1 1/2 cup of water and mix well. Keep this aside
Finely chop ginger, green chillies, garlic, shallots and tomato.
Heat 2 tbsp of oil and add mustard seeds followed by urad dal, cumin seeds, fenugreek seeds, red chilli and hing.
When mustard seeds start spluttering, add finely chopped pearl onions (shallots), ginger, green chillies, garlic and curry leaves.
Saute until onions turn transparent.
Once it turns transparent, add the chopped tomatoes, turmeric powder, salt and chilli powder.
Cook until tomatoes turn mushy. If you feel the tomatoes are dry, you may add a tbsp of water.
Once the tomatoes are cooked well, add the gram flour mix.
Mix well and simmer for 4-5 minutes. Keep stirring in between.
Once done, garnish with finely chopped coriander leaves.
Serve bombay sambar piping hot with idli, dosa or pongal.
Note - The sambar should be watery. If it becomes too thick, add more water and simmer for few minutes.
You may adjust seasoning according to your taste.
